What is a Shipping Container?

A shipping container is a big standardized steel box designed for carrying products. These containers are built to hold up against extreme climate condition and rough handling throughout shipping, making them robust storage solutions for different applications. They are available in various sizes and types, offering flexibility for different requirements.

Why Rent a Shipping Container?

Renting a shipping container can be a perfect solution for numerous factors. Here are a number of elements to consider:

  1. Cost-Effectiveness: Renting can be more economical than acquiring a shipping container, particularly for short-term requirements.
  2. Flexibility: Renting permits businesses or individuals to adjust to changing area requirements without a long-term dedication.
  3. Immediate Availability: Shipping containers can frequently be leased and delivered rapidly, providing instant solutions for urgent storage requirements.
  4. Variety of Sizes: Different projects need different sizes. Leasing enables you to choose the size that fits your particular needs without the storage problem of excess space.
  5. Adaptability: Containers can be used for a wide variety of functions, including storage, momentary offices, pop-up stores, and living spaces.

Costs Involved in Renting Shipping Containers

When thinking about leasing a shipping container, it's important to comprehend the costs included. Below is a basic breakdown of what you may expect to pay:

Type of ContainerSizeRegular Monthly Rental Cost (Approx.)Extra Costs
Standard20ft₤ 100 - ₤ 200Delivery fees, pickup charges, and upkeep
Basic40ft₤ 150 - ₤ 300Delivery fees, pickup fees, and upkeep
High Cube20ft₤ 120 - ₤ 220Delivery costs, pickup costs, and upkeep
High Cube40ft₤ 180 - ₤ 350Delivery fees, pickup costs, and maintenance

Keep in mind: Prices might vary based upon area, condition of the container (new or used), and duration of rental.

Actions to Renting a Shipping Container

Leasing a shipping container can be straightforward if you follow these actions:

  1. Determine Your Needs: Evaluate what size and type of container you need based on your particular requirements.
  2. Research Suppliers: Look for reputable shipping container rental business in your location. Online reviews and reviews can be useful.
  3. Get Quotes: Contact several providers to request quotes. Compare prices and services to find the very best deal.
  4. Look For Additional Costs: Inquire about delivery costs, rental agreements, and any possible upkeep costs.
  5. Check the Container: If possible, inspect the container before renting to ensure it meets your requirements.
  6. Complete the Rental Agreement: Read the rental arrangement carefully, keeping in mind any terms related to damage, insurance coverage, and returns.
